Child-Net, Inc. is a licensed, non-profit after-school program and summer day camp for rising kindergarten through 6th grade children.  We provide accessible and affordable after-school care in the Rockbridge Area.  Child-Net is a member of the Lexington-Rockbridge United Way and is also funded by your donations, which are tax-deductible.

 

Child-Net provides children with a  supervised and safe place for after-school hours in our three centers, Waddell Elementary (Lexington), Fairfield Elementary, and
Natural Bridge Elementary.

Child-Net is licensed by the Virginia Department of Social Services and provides transportation during the academic year from Central Elementary to Waddell by bus.

 

 

Daily Schedule During the Academic Year:

3:00 - 3:15  Check-in
3:15 - 3:45 Independent activities
3:45 - 4:00 Snack
4:00 - 5:00 Free play (outdoor, weather permitting)
or supervised homework
5:00 - 5:30 Inside activities
5:30 - 5:45 Closing
